There are > errors about not being about to find lvm.h and > liblvm.h. I copied them to /usr/include, and then it > got farther but complained about gnu/types.h. After > symlinking that, I got an error about lots of > redeclarations. What's going on? Thanks. At least for glibc2.1 you need a patch for the user mode tools, otherwise compile fails. Please install patch patch-lvm_0.8final-2 For a list of know issues please have a look at http://linux.msede.com/lvm/doc/BUGS Instead of copying lvm.h to /usr/include you should modify the KERNEL_LOCATION in make.tmpl. By default it assumes your kernel sources in /usr/src/linux.
